The Code Talkers’ Role in the War Effort

The Code Talkers were recruited from various tribes across the United States, including the Navajo, Hopi, Comanche, and many others. These Native American soldiers were trained to use their native languages to transmit coded messages that the enemy could not decipher. The code was so effective that even other Native American soldiers who spoke different languages could not understand the messages.

The Code Talkers were instrumental in several key battles during the war, including the Battle of Iwo Jima. The Marines who fought in that battle credited the Code Talkers for helping them achieve victory. The Navajo Language and its Role in Code Talking

One of the most notable groups of code talkers were the Navajo, whose language proved to be an ideal candidate for use in code talking. The Navajo language is incredibly complex, with over 400 distinct sounds and a grammar system that is entirely different from English. This complexity made it almost impossible for the enemy to decipher the messages, even if they managed to intercept them.

The Recruitment and Training of Code Talkers

Recruiting code talkers was not an easy task, as the government needed to find people who were fluent in their indigenous languages and willing to serve in the military. To do this, recruiters traveled across the country to Native American reservations, looking for suitable candidates. Once selected, the code talkers underwent rigorous training, which included learning how to encode and decode messages quickly and accurately.

The Secret Code and its Importance in Military Operations

The code used by the Navajo code talkers was incredibly complex, with each word represented by a unique phrase or combination of words. This code proved to be invaluable in military operations, as it allowed the Allies to communicate quickly and securely. The code was so effective that it was never broken by the enemy, even after the war was over.
